Menthol Mint Cultivation, Processing and Market Linkages Consultancy​

Menthol mint is commercially valuable only when cultivation, distillation, product quality and market access are planned as one integrated enterprise. Also called Japanese mint, cornmint or mentha, Mentha arvensis is an important essential-oil crop and the principal natural source of menthol.

Mentha oil and its processed products—including natural menthol crystals, menthol flakes, dementholised mint oil and refined mint fractions—are used in pharmaceuticals, oral-care products, confectionery, cosmetics, personal care, flavours and fragrances.

India has a substantial mentha industry. According to the Spices Board’s 2025–26 figures, India exported 23,944 tonnes of mint products valued at ₹3,135.30 crore. However, export demand, crop area, oil recovery, processor inventories, synthetic-menthol competition and currency movements can influence prices. Commercial cultivation should therefore be based on realistic feasibility analysis, not temporary market prices.

Scientific menthol mint cultivation requires a suitable location, fertile and well-drained soil, assured irrigation, authentic disease-free suckers and a carefully designed crop calendar. Variety selection, nutrient management, weed control, integrated pest and disease management, harvesting stage and timely distillation directly affect oil recovery and quality.
